Donna Ashworth is a #1 Sunday Times bestselling poet, whose words you will often find flying around the internet, widely shared daily, by her 2 million plus followers.

Donna’s writing came to the spotlight during lockdown when she saw her purpose as building a place to find hope, calm and comfort amid the collective chaos. She quickly became an internet favourite with one viral post after another.

Donna prides herself on being ‘imperfectly human’ and ‘sharing the dark with the light to harness hope’. She engages constantly with her followers in a bid to find comfort in numbers as we ‘walk each other home’ on this journey of life. donnaashworth.com
